Federal contributions from ZIP 40202: $13.0M
$13.0M in FEC.gov itemized receipts list contributor ZIP 40202. The exact aggregate is $12,973,841 across 23,468 contributions. 40202 is the contributor ZIP covering downtown Louisville streets, not a metro Louisville household census. Joint-fundraising and PAC mail using 40202 count in the same roll-up as a Main Street or Fourth Street listing.

23,468 contributions without a donor roster
The extract lists 23,468 contributions for 40202. That is a receipt count, not a unique-person census. This packet does not include a distinct-donor total, so this guide does not invent how many people sit behind downtown Louisville filings. A mid-length file at $13.0M can still mix large committee transfers with small itemized gifts. Repeat gifts and memo entries still add rows. Dollars divided by lines is about $553; that arithmetic is useful only as a shape note next to ZIPs with similar dollars and different row counts.

40202 as a contributor ZIP
Committees report a five-digit contributor ZIP. Fourth Street offices, high-rise mail, and committee addresses can share 40202. Quote $13.0M as ZIP-tagged federal disclosure. Swap that phrase for “downtown Louisville residents spent” only if the hub rows actually support it. This page will not invent a residential-versus-office split that the packet omitted.
The packet has no residency filter beyond the ZIP box. A contributor who lists a downtown Louisville address, or a committee that files 40202, adds to the same roll-up when that ZIP is on the itemization. A downtown Louisville street and a committee that files 40202 both increment the same roll-up. Keep the five digits intact in spreadsheets. Dropped leading zeros and truncated codes fail to match 40202.
